Animal Scientific Officer
2 weeks ago
Your new company
Hays are proud to be working alongside a world-leading independent charity organisation, based in the centre of Manchester for an exciting opportunity as an Animal Scientific Officer.
Your new role
This role involves providing day-to-day care and welfare monitoring of laboratory animals within the Experimental Team of the Biological Resources Unit. You will support research teams by conducting experimental procedures, ensuring compliance with regulations, and maintaining high standards of care in line with the Animals (Scientific Procedures) Act 1986. The position requires working closely with internal teams to facilitate oncology research while ensuring ethical and welfare considerations are met.
- Carry out routine animal husbandry, welfare checks, and environmental monitoring.
- Perform surgical and non-surgical experimental procedures under Personal Licence authority.
- Maintain accurate records of observations, procedures, and research data.
- Assist with the training of staff in licensed and non-licensed techniques.
- Ensure compliance with the Animals (Scientific Procedures) Act 1986 and institutional policies.
- Support research teams in developing and optimising in vivo models.
- Contribute to the general upkeep and hygiene of the facility.
- Participate in weekend and bank holiday rota cover as required.
- HNC/HND in Animal Technology, a related degree, or equivalent experience.
- Experience working in a laboratory animal facility or similar research environment.
- Current or previous holder of a Personal Licence (PIL A & B) under the Animals (Scientific Procedures) Act 1986.
- Knowledge of laboratory animal welfare, oncology models, and relevant regulations.
- Strong organisational skills with the ability to manage tasks effectively.
-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al.
- Ability to work flexibly, including occasional out-of-hours shifts.
